If you lived in California instead of Denmark, you would:

Health

live 2.7 years less

In Denmark, the average life expectancy is 82 years (80 years for men, 84 years for women) as of 2022. In California, that number is 79 years (78 years for men, 83 years for women) as of 2020.

Economy

make 16.7% more money

Denmark has a GDP per capita of $72,000 as of 2023, while in California, the GDP per capita is $84,028 as of 2024.
